Social Rubber Bands: A Comprehensive Guide to Understanding and Analyzing the Impact of Social Dynamics on Economics. This textbook provides a thorough exploration of social rubber bands, their historical significance, theoretical foundations, and economic consequences. It examines the role of institutions, the implications for market efficiency and economic growth, and offers policy recommendations for addressing social rubber band issues. Perfect for students, researchers, and policymakers seeking to understand the complexities of social dynamics in economics.
